- [ ] Step 7: Archive cold storage buckets (Glacierline tier). Confirm both ceremony witnesses are present, verify bucket manifests match the Oxbow ledger, then seal the archive key shares. Plugin authors may observe but not handle shares. Once sealed, the archive index itself is encrypted and can only be reopened with the passphrase below.

vault phrase of badup-hahig = tamael-aldael-kelmir-istael-fenok-istwyn-tamius-jorath-oliion

New reviewers on the Hallsong audio-guide app should know that tour audio is bundled per-exhibit and fetched lazily when a visitor scans a gallery marker. Pull requests touching the playback engine need sign-off from the Murrowgate platform team, and changes to offline caching require a storage-budget check. The review checklist, coding conventions, and merge rules are all kept on the internal page linked below.

operations page: https://jira.zemvarlabs.internal/pages/browse/pages/2456c046

Internal Memo — Uniform consignment, Wrenhall Depot opening

To the records team: the initial uniform order for the new Wrenhall Depot has been completed by Sterrow Garments and packed into four labelled cartons, sorted by size band. Please register each carton number, note the fabric batch codes, and file the supplier's packing list with the opening documentation.

The confidential courier hand-over instruction is appended directly below.

courier memo of tawep-tajep: the quenius ulaiel courier leaves the fenir ledger at gate 9128 under passcode 527513

## Runbook: SDK Parity Checks (Lantern)

Welcome aboard! We ship two client SDKs for Lantern — one in Kotlin, one in Swift — and they're supposed to expose identical surface area. The `parity-bot` job diffs the generated API manifests nightly and files a gap report if anything drifts. If you add a method to one SDK, add it to both or the bot will nag the whole channel. To run the parity check locally, the bot needs access to the Lantern manifest service, authenticated with the key below.

service key, fawip-bajef: kto11_Qt5wZK9vdNC